The Corporate Officer of the House of Commons and the Corporate Officer of the House of Lords (acting jointly) invite interested suppliers to submit a request to participate in a supplier day for a Commercial Off The Shelf (COTS) solution to deliver a new ticketing solution for tours and events.
As a World Heritage site and the home of UK democracy, Parliament places huge importance on being accessible to all, through a wide range of channels.
Both the House of Commons and the House of Lords have ongoing strategic aims to engage the public with Parliament's role and work.
We have an ambition to include (but not limit to) the booking solution to the following services: - paid for visits including tours and events at UK Parliament https://www.parliament.uk/visiting/ - "inside Uk Parliament tours (a free offering to UK residents) - internal events at UK Parliament.
The contract should include but is not limited to: - online and onsite ticketing and reporting - support services - hosting options - integration options (for example with a visitor management system) - hardware ( such as card payment devices for in person payment) Please note: we have recently migrated our educational visit and tour bookings to a Dynamics 365 platform.
This user journey is therefore not within scope.
The procurement route is still being considered.
The estimated budget is £500,000 - £1,000,000 In order to assist in understanding the market, the Authority is holding a supplier event(s) on 11th or 12th November.
Depending on the level of interest the event may be held in person on the Parliamentary estate or remotely.
Further information and confirmation of the format of the event will be shared prior to the event.
To register your interest in this event, please navigate to https://atamis-ukparliament.my.site.com/s/Welcome.
The deadline for registration is 14:00hrs, Friday, 24th October 2025.
